Council sets March 12 public hearing for Stonegate Development Phase II

Harrison City Council · February 12, 2025

The Harrison City Council scheduled a continuation hearing on the Stonegate Development Agreement Phase II for March 12 at 5:00 PM; the motion passed 5–1, with Will Butler opposed.

Councilmember Josephine Prophet moved to set a continuation public hearing on the Stonegate Development Agreement (Phase II) for March 12 at 5:00 PM; Charlie Shutt seconded the motion and it passed 5–1. Will Butler was the sole dissenting vote.

The hearing was set to allow additional public input and administrative preparation; the council did not discuss substantive project details at length during this meeting. Staff did not provide a project packet or schedule for the hearing during the Feb. 12 meeting.
